HOUSE RESOLUTION HONORING REV. DR. BERNARD LAFAYETTE JR. FOR HIS CONTRIBUTIONS TO THE STATE OF RHODE ISLAND

Summary

The House of Representatives adopted a resolution that formally honors the late Rev. Dr. Bernard LaFayette Jr., recognizing his contributions to civil‑rights, nonviolence education, and public service in Rhode Island and nationally. The resolution expresses gratitude, offers condolences to his family, and directs the Secretary of State to send certified copies of the resolution to his family.
